The kinetic energy 22,500 joules
The calculation can be done as follows
mass= 0.5 kg
time= 300 m/s
Kinetic energy= 1/2mv²
= 1/2 × 0.5 × 300²
= 0.5 × 0.5 × 90,000
= 22,500
Hence the Kinetic Energy is 22,500 joules

Answer: B
Mean of 3 and Standard deviation of 5
Explanation:
Performing operations on means of independent variables is similar to performing arithmetic operations on natural numbers.
Subtracting the mean of S from R is 10 - 7 = 3
For the difference in standard deviation. It should be noted that when combining variables, the variation within the distribution. So therefore, adding or subtraction of variables, the variation will increase and will yield same answer.
To obtain the difference in standard deviation, the variances of the random variables has to be added and then the square root will be taken to return back to standard deviation.
SD(R-S)=sqrt(R²+S²)
SD=sqrt(4²+3³)
SD=sqrt(25)
SD=5
